Apple could look to launch a larger-screen iPod touch in the fall of 2009, according to The Washington Post's TechCrunch.com.

Apple has developed prototypes and is holding production talks with OEMs in Asia regarding mass production, according to the paper.

The devices would have a 7- or 9-inch screen, according TechCrunch, which compares to the current 3.5-inch screen of the current generation of iPod touch.

The site doesn't compare a larger iPod touch to a Netbook, but notes that Apple has experimented internally with tablet devices for years.

Earlier this year, Apple created some buzz after reports of some tablet-like patent applications. In August, AppleInsider.com described a 52-page document with illustrations that include such features as a touch-screen keyboard and more.
